Role Overview

We are seeking a Configuration & Data Management Specialist to provide configuration and data management expertise across fixed and rotary wing defence programmes. This role supports engineering, programme, and supplier teams to ensure configuration control, data integrity, and compliance with contractual, regulatory, and security requirements throughout the product lifecycle.
The position is predominantly office-based due to the nature of the programmes supported.

Key Responsibilities

Configuration Management

Support the planning and implementation of Configuration and Data Management activities across programmes

Assist with the deployment of standardised configuration management processes across the organisation

Identify risks, issues, and opportunities, supporting the development of mitigation plans

Support the standardisation of configuration management toolsets, including security and access controls

Interface with bid and programme teams to ensure configuration management requirements are embedded at contract initiation and review

Contribute to Supplier Statements of Work for Configuration and Data Management proposals

Provide input into budgeting and forecasting activities related to configuration management

Programme-Specific Configuration Management

Deliver Configuration and Data Management activities in line with programme contractual requirements

Liaise with customers and suppliers to agree joint working processes and procedures

Support programme control boards, ensuring consistency across programmes

Ensure delivery of control board outputs and timely closure of actions

Provide configuration management support at design and programme reviews

Schedule, track, and manage Supplier Data Requirements Lists (SDRLs)

Ensure timely review, disposition, and approval of supplier data

Data Management

Track and report data transmissions to ensure compliance with contractual, regulatory, and configuration requirements

Manage customer and supplier data deliverables

Ensure adherence to export compliance, licensing agreements, security, and intellectual property regulations

Support internal audits and reviews

Maintain virtual environments used for sharing technical data across multiple sites, including offline backup systems

Review technical data for security, trade control, and IP markings prior to approval
